1" in latitude represents a distance of about 102 feet.

1" of longitude represents a distance of about 102 feet along the equator.

The farther from the equator you are, the shorter 1" of longitude becomes.

At the north and south poles, all longitudes converge in one point.

How does latitude and longitude work together to pinpoint a specific location on Earth?

Latitude and longitude are coordinates used to pinpoint a specific location on Earth. Latitude measures how far north or south a location is from the equator, while longitude measures how far east or west a location is from the Prime Meridian. By using both latitude and longitude together, you can accurately determine the exact position of a place on Earth's surface.
